Monday, January 01, 2007

New Memphis Stadium??


Memphis has the highest property taxes in the entire State. They have just mothballed the old Pyramid arena. They have a still brewing scandal over the parking garage for the Fedex forum, and now the Mayor is proposing a new football stadium.

The taxpayers will be thrilled.